José Luis Martínez‐Ordaz is a scholar working on Surgery,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, José Luis Martínez‐Ordaz has authored 67 papers receiving a total of 471 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 46 papers in Surgery, 32 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 8 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in José Luis Martínez‐Ordaz’s work include Abdominal Surgery and Complications (16 papers), Hernia repair and management (8 papers) and Gastrointestinal disorders and treatments (8 papers). José Luis Martínez‐Ordaz is often cited by papers focused on Abdominal Surgery and Complications (16 papers), Hernia repair and management (8 papers) and Gastrointestinal disorders and treatments (8 papers). José Luis Martínez‐Ordaz collaborates with scholars based in Mexico, United States and Spain. José Luis Martínez‐Ordaz's co-authors include Enrique Luque-de-León, Juan Mier, José D. Méndez, Marco Antonio Juárez-Oropeza, Rubén Román‐Ramos, Luis Mauricio Hurtado‐López, Eduardo Ferat‐Osorio, Carmen González, Patricio Sánchez Fernández and Anita Bhattacharyya and has published in prestigious journals such as Gastroenterology, Archives of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ation and The American Journal of Surgery.
